Pachacuti · 19/09/2013 11:45

There was an episode where Harvey got a better job bringing in more money, so that the family lifestyle looked set to improve, they'd be able to move to a bigger house, etc., but he was desperately unhappy and Mary-Beth told him to go back to old job. At least I think she did.

Harvey being in a low-powered job was a big part of how he was available to be hands-on with the kids and support Mary-Beth's awkward hours, I think.
